Features
The Kidde i12040 smoke alarm offers a tamper-resistant feature to deter vandalism or theft and a intelligent interconnect method that connects with up to 24 Kidde devices--including other smoke alarms plus carbon monoxide and heat alarms. The battery-backup feature (9-volt battery included) gives protection even during power outages when a number of CO incidences happen. It has a massive mounting base that assists shield surface paint from dirt and covers imperfections, and its pre-stripped wiring harness has an easy-off cap and tinned strands to enhance conductivity.
By pressing the hush button, you can without difficulty and safely silence nuisance alarms triggered by non-emergency situations, such as overcooked dinners. This feature desensitizes the alarm for approximately seven minutes. For the duration of this time, the alarm chirps each and every 30 to 40 seconds. If the smoke is too dense, the hush feature is overridden and the alarm nonetheless sounds, and the alarm automatically resets at the end of the seven minutes. This convenient security measure eliminates the temptation to take away the alarm's battery, which creates an unsafe situation.
The Kidde i12040 smoke alarm makes use of ionization sensing technology, which may well detect invisible fire particles (associated with flaming fires) sooner than photoelectric alarms. Photoelectric sensing alarms may detect visible particles (linked with smoldering fires) sooner than ionization alarms. Kidde recommends that each ionization and photoelectric smoke alarms be installed to insure maximum detection.

From the Manufacturer
There are only minutes to escape a residence fire. The sooner you hear the smoke alarm, the sooner you can get out safely. Kidde interconnected ionization smoke alarms present early warning against fire by linking together the smoke alarms in your household, significantly rising your capacity to hear an alarm anyplace, regardless of exactly where the fire begins. This alarm is a 120V AC powered ionization smoke alarm with 9V battery back-up and hush feature. This smoke alarm has the ability to function as a single unit or in an interconnected program. Install UL listed smoke alarms on every single floor of your residence, in hallways, inside bedrooms, and outside of sleeping places and replace smoke alarms every 10 years. Ionization sensing alarms may very well detect invisible fire particles sooner than photoelectric alarms. Scientific studies show each varieties will efficiently detect either kind of fire. For optimal protection, install each smoke alarm technologies in your residence.

The purpose of a smoke alarm is to alert you to a fire in your home. Thankfully I have in no way been in a position to test this unit, and I hope I never ever have the chance. So I will just assessment the other causes I bought this item.
I bought two of these units to replace older Kiddie model 1275 units that had been malfunctioning and going off frequently for false alarms. My major concern was compatibility given that I have ten units in my residence and did not want to replace them all. These new units used the very same wiring, connectors, and mounting frames as the old units which was best -- installation took less than a minute per unit. The new units work with the old units perfectly -- pushing the test button on the new ones set off all the alarms in the property, just as they must.
I did have some hesitation about choosing new Kiddie units considering that the old Kiddie units were malfunctioning. (To be fair, only one particular was malfunctioning, but I was tired of messing with troubleshooting and decided to replace the last two selections.) Yet, only 1 in ten of my current units was malfunctioning, and they are 6 years old (out of a reported ten year lifetime). The smoke alarms had been installed when I bought the home, so I can not be certain the failing unit was not dropped or otherwise abused just before installation. So far the new units have not made any false alarms and are operating nicely.
I had a residence full of Kidde 1275 smoke alarms, and right after several malfunctions (including 1 electrical dilemma causing it to actually "go up in smoke"), I replaced them with the i12040 ... only mainly because I wanted a thing that would "drop in" with the current mounting technique and wiring. That they did, and I've had no false alarms in the month they've been installed.
